How can I tell if physical therapy is the right choice for my condition?

We can help you answer this question with our FREE 15-minute discovery call. We know that everyone's case is unique and we want to make sure you get the correct care even if that means referring you to another professional. Some conditions that may improve with physical therapy: sports-related or other acute injuries, post-operative pain, joint pain, chronic pain, aging (yes, really), and musculoskeletal disorders.
